摘要
引进黑龙江省大豆品种黑河38,对不同播期处理的产量性状、生育期结构、叶面积指数消长、生物产量积累动态、器官平衡等进行了比较。结果表明:该品种在沈阳地区种植,随着播期延迟,生育日数逐渐缩短,最大叶面积指数下降、单株生物产量的积累减少。各播期间单株粒数、百粒重、小区产量差异显著,单位面积产量以6月9日播种最高,迟至7月11日播种,仍可获得较高产量,可作为春小麦或马铃薯下茬利用。以黑河、沈阳两地同期播种相比较,产量和品质差异较大。
There are few soybean varietes suitable for summer planting in Liaoning Province, and soybean germplasm introduced from higher latitude would solve this problem. The soybean variety Heihe 38, introduced from Heihe, Heilongjiang Province, was planted in Shenyang from 23th, April to 11 th, July. Yield character, structure of growing stage, dynamic change of leaf area index(LAI) and biomass accumulation and equilibrium of plant organ were determined. Result showed that biological yield accumulation ,LAI ,and growing days were decreased with the delaying of sowing time in Shenyang. The highest yield was got when Heihe 38 was planted on 9th June. There were significant difference of seeds per plant, weight of 100- seed and yield among different sowing date treatment, a good yield was also obtained when planting on 11 th July. There were significant difference on yield traits and quality between Shenyang and Heihe in the same sowing date. The results suggest that Heihe 18 can be planted in Shenyang as an relay - planting crop after harvesting spring wheat and potato.
